John H. Stiles Junior, age twenty, is home after 14 months duty with the Navy in the Southwest Pacific. He has been in the Navy since September 1942. His ship, the USS Helena was sunk last July 6 in the battle of Kula Gulf. He was in the water six hours watching the battle before being picked up by a destroyer. He is visiting is parents, Mr. and Mrs. John H. Stiles, Sr., 2016 Mitchell Boulevard. Stiles attended William James Junior High School. Seaman stiles is in dress blues with two stars on his ribbon for major engagements. Published in the Fort Worth Star-Telegram morning edition, April 27, 1944.
